Brock Solutions is an engineering solutions and professional services company specializing in the design, build and implementation of real-time solutions for broad based industrial/manufacturing and transportation/logistics organizations worldwide.

With approximately 500 employees globally, Brock Solutions is a privately held, employee owned organization with over 30 years in the real-time solutions space.
